Ambiq Semiconductor's Cutting-Edge Microcontrollers: Revolutionizing Low Power Design

In the ever-evolving landscape of embedded systems, energy efficiency is paramount. Ambiq's cutting-edge microcontrollers have emerged as a leading solution for designers seeking to optimize their projects. Built on advanced low-power technologies, these microcontrollers deliver exceptional performance while minimizing usage.

One of the key features of Ambiq's microcontrollers is their unique architecture. The company's proprietary subthreshold power-saving technology allows devices to operate at incredibly low voltages, significantly extending battery life. This makes them ideal for a wide range of applications, including wearables, IoT devices, and industrial controls.

Additionally, Ambiq's microcontrollers boast impressive processing performance. They feature multiple cores and a high-speed memory interface, enabling them to handle demanding functions with ease. This combination of low power consumption and high performance makes Ambiq's microcontrollers the perfect choice for designers who need to balance both factors in their products.
